Market Overview The global AI in healthcare market is projected to expand significantly, rising from USD 36.02 billion in 2025 to USD 250.08 billion by 2031, demonstrating a compound annual growth rate of 38.12%. Artificial intelligence in healthcare involves leveraging machine learning, natural language processing, and other cognitive technologies to analyze medical data, thereby assisting in diagnosis, optimizing treatment plans, and improving administrative efficiencies. This substantial market growth is fundamentally propelled by the escalating volume of intricate healthcare data, the urgent necessity to curtail operational expenditures, and the increasing worldwide incidence of chronic diseases demanding ongoing oversight. These core elements establish a robust foundation for integrating computational intelligence into clinical processes to enhance decision-making and patient outcomes. In 2024, a notable 66% of physicians reported utilizing artificial intelligence in their practice, according to the American Medical Association, indicating a considerable increase in adoption. However, a significant obstacle to further market expansion stems from inadequate data interoperability and ongoing concerns surrounding patient data privacy. The fragmented nature of health information systems leads to data silos, which impede the seamless exchange of information essential for training sophisticated algorithms and implementing scalable AI solutions across varied healthcare environments. Market Driver A primary driver fueling the AI in healthcare market is the global shortage of healthcare professionals and the pervasive issue of clinician burnout. Health systems are actively seeking automated solutions to address the growing disparity between patient demand and available workforce capacity. This structural deficit necessitates the use of intelligent systems to enhance human capabilities, particularly by alleviating administrative responsibilities and optimizing diagnostic processes. For instance, Philips' 'Future Health Index 2025' report, May 2025, forecasts a critical shortfall of 11 million health workers by 2030, underscoring the urgent need for technological intervention. As a result, healthcare providers are quickly incorporating AI tools to uphold care standards, a trend further supported by Elsevier's 'Clinician of the Future 2025' report, July 2025, which indicates that 48% of clinicians have already employed an artificial intelligence tool in their professional work. Furthermore, the accelerated adoption of AI for drug discovery and development significantly contributes to market expansion by transforming the pharmaceutical research pipeline. Traditional approaches, often marked by high failure rates and extended timelines, are increasingly being replaced by generative algorithms that can identify promising drug candidates with greater efficiency. This paradigm shift encourages substantial investment in computational platforms, which in turn reduces the capital investment required to introduce new therapeutics to the market. The strategic importance of this application is clear; according to NVIDIA's 'State of AI in Healthcare and Life Sciences: 2025 Trends' report, March 2025, 62% of pharmaceutical and biotechnology company respondents identified drug discovery as their leading generative AI application. Market Challenge A significant impediment to the growth of the global AI in healthcare market is the lack of data interoperability, coupled with ongoing concerns about patient data privacy. Artificial intelligence models depend on extensive, varied, and interconnected datasets to generate precise clinical insights and ensure effective outcomes across diverse patient groups. Nevertheless, the prevailing healthcare environment is characterized by disjointed information systems that confine vital medical records within isolated silos. This fragmented infrastructure obstructs the effortless collection of data essential for training resilient algorithms, consequently limiting the scalability of AI solutions and diminishing their dependability when deployed in various clinical environments. These operational inefficiencies are exacerbated by considerable worries regarding the security of sensitive health information, which often results in stringent data governance policies. Such caution slows the rate of innovation as organizations frequently prioritize mitigating risks over integrating new technologies. The Healthcare Information and Management Systems Society reported in 2024 that 72% of healthcare professionals viewed data privacy as a major concern regarding AI adoption. This prevalent apprehension hinders market expansion by complicating compliance efforts and delaying the implementation of potentially transformative computational tools. Market Trends A significant trend observed is the adoption of generative AI for clinical documentation, which is fundamentally transforming provider workflows by shifting from manual data entry to ambient listening and automated note creation. This approach involves deploying natural language processing tools within patient rooms to record consultations in real-time, allowing physicians to maintain direct engagement and rapport with patients instead of focusing on computer screens. Healthcare systems are actively integrating these solutions to enhance documentation accuracy and reduce the cognitive burden associated with electronic health records. The Scottsdale Institute's 'Adoption of Artificial Intelligence in Healthcare' survey, May 2025, indicated that 53% of health systems reported high success with AI in clinical documentation, suggesting this technology is quickly moving beyond initial pilot phases. Another critical trend is the emergence of autonomous agentic AI, which signifies an evolution from merely passive analysis to proactive operational execution within healthcare organizations. In contrast to conventional chatbots, these independent agents are capable of performing intricate, multi-step tasks such as scheduling appointments, processing claims, and triaging patient inquiries without requiring human intervention. This move towards agentic workflows empowers institutions to efficiently scale their operations while upholding high service standards for patients. The strategic importance of this technology is increasingly acknowledged; Google Cloud's 'The ROI of AI in Healthcare and Life Sciences' report, October 2025, found that 34% of healthcare executives identified technical support and patient experience as the primary applications for autonomous AI agents, emphasizing their expanding role in automating core business functions.
